Ordinals
beta
Sat 8429811085428
decimal
511.1011085428
percentile
0.016859622170856%
name
mpcjedlrwxij
cycle
0
epoch
2
block
511
offset
1011085428
timestamp
2023-12-07 00:08:43 UTC
rarity
common
prev
next